Are electric cars expensive ?

Yes but mostly because it's a fairly new and small-scale technology. Things become cheap when you make a lot of them because then you can buy the raw materials in bulk and set up assembly lines, etc. When you're making a small number of a product, you can't buy as large quantities of the raw materials, so they cost more, so they end product costs more.

how long does it to recharge electric vehicles

This completely depends upon the specifications of the Battery used in the electric car and the charger rating. It generally takes around 8-12 Hrs for a complete charging cycle. 

Is it hard to travel long distance with electric cars?

The majority of battery powered cars that are available today have a range of between 40 miles (65km) and 100 miles (160km), which is far more than most people travel on a regular basis:

  • According to the UK Department for Transport, that the average car journey is 6½ miles (10½km) with 93% of all journeys being less than 25 miles (40km).
  • According to the US Department of Transportation, an average American driver travels 29 miles (46½km) per day by car, with an average single journey of around 12 miles (19km).
  • Many people never travel more than 50 miles (80km) from their homes and many more will only travel further than 50 miles a few times each year.

Are electric vehicles slow

A very basic gas-powered car can easily take you up to 100 mph. An exotic, expensive thrill machine like the Bugatti Veyron can get you to more than 200 mph. In between, you have all manner of options, from drag-racer-type American cars that go fast in a straight line to “driver’s” machines like Porsches and BMWs.

Electric cars will mirror this, but with one very important distinction: They will almost all have surprising acceleration. This is due to a peculiarity of electric motors, which deliver maximum torque at 1 RPM. Gas-powered cars build up their torque over the RPM curve, which just means that acceleration can seem more gradual. Whereas even a mass-market E.V. feels, to a certain extent, like a race car. 

Will Electric Vehicles Really Reduce Pollution?

 An electric vehicle that is charged with energy from a clean source, like hydroelectric power, will produce very little pollution, while one charged with energy from an unclean source, like coal or oil, may produce more pollution than an internal combustion engine vehicle.
